首頁 > 常見問題 > ipv4位址是ip位址嗎

ipv4位址是ip位址嗎

青灯夜游
發布: 2022-09-21 14:22:11
原創
23404 人瀏覽過

ipv4位址是ip位址。 IP位址是IP協定提供的一種統一的位址格式,可分成兩類:1、ipv4位址,是網路協定開發過程中的第四個修訂版本,也是此協定第一個被廣泛部署的版本;2 、IPv6位址,是互聯網工程任務組(IETF)設計的用於替代IPv4的下一代IP協議,其地址數量號稱可以為全世界的每一粒沙子編上一個地址。

ipv4位址是ip位址嗎

本教學操作環境:windows7系統、Dell G3電腦。

IP位址(Internet Protocol Address)是指網際網路協定位址,又譯為網路協定位址。

IP位址是IP協定提供的一種統一的位址格式,它為網路上的每一個網路和每一台主機分配一個邏輯位址,以此來屏蔽實體位址的差異。

現在的ip位址有兩類:ipv4和IPv6。

發展歷程:

首先出現的IP位址是IPV4,它只有4段數字,每一段最大不超過255。由於網路的蓬勃發展,IP地址的需求量愈來愈大,使得IP地址的發放愈趨嚴格,各項資料顯示全球IPv4地址可能在2005至2010年間全部發完(實際情況是在2019年11月25日IPv4位址分配完畢)。位址空間的不足必將妨礙網路的進一步發展。為了擴大位址空間,擬透過IPv6重新定義位址空間。 IPv6採用128位元位址長度。在IPv6的設計過程中除了一勞永逸地解決了地址短缺問題以外,還考慮了在IPv4中解決不好的其它問題。 

現有的網際網路是在IPv4協定的基礎上運作的。 IPv6是下一個版本的互聯網協議,也可以說是下一代互聯網的協議,它的提出最初是因為隨著互聯網的迅速發展,IPv4定義的有限地址空間將被耗盡,而地址空間的不足必將妨礙互聯網的進一步發展。為了擴大位址空間,擬透過IPv6重新定義位址空間。 IPv4採用32位址長度,只有大約43億個位址,估計在2005~2010年間將被分配完畢,而IPv6採用128位元位址長度,幾乎可以不受限制地提供位址。以保守方法估算IPv6實際可分配的位址,整個地球的每平方公尺面積仍可分配1000多個位址。在IPv6的設計過程中除解決了地址短缺問題以外,還考慮了在IPv4中解決不好的其它一些問題,主要有端對端IP連接、服務品質(QoS)、安全性、多播、移動性、即插即用等。

隨著網路的快速發展和網路使用者對服務水準要求的不斷提高,IPv6在全球將會越來越受到重視。實際上,並不急於推廣IPv6,只需在現有的IPv4基礎上將32位擴展8位到40位,即可解決IPv4地址不夠的問題。這樣一來可用地址數就擴大了256倍。

ipv4位址

網際網路協定版本4(英文:Internet Protocol version 4,IPv4),又稱網路通訊協定第四版,是網際協定開發過程中的第四個修訂版本,也是此協定第一個廣泛部署的版本。 IPv4是網際網路的核心,也是使用最廣泛的網路協定版本,其後繼版本為IPv6,直到2011年,IANA IPv4位址完全用盡時,IPv6仍處在部署的初期。

IPv4在IETF於1981年9月發布的 RFC 791 中被描述,此RFC取代了於1980年1月發布的 RFC 760。

IPv4是一種無連線的協議,操作在使用分組交換的連結層(如乙太網路)上。此協議會盡最大努力交付資料包,意即它不保證任何資料包均能送達目的地,也不保證所有資料包均按照正確的順序無重複地到達。這些方面是由上層的傳輸協定(如傳輸控制協定)處理的。

IPv4使用32位元2進位位元的位址,因此大約只有43億個位址。最初每個連接入網際網路的使用者都要分配使用一個IPv4 位址,因此未分配的IPv4位址越來越少,由此產生了IPv4位址耗盡的問題。為了根本解決IPv4位址耗盡的問題,IPv6應運而生。

IPv4通常用點分十進位記法書寫,例如192.168.0.1,其中的數字都是十進制的數字,中間用實心圓點分隔。

一個IPv4位址可以分成網路位址和主機位址兩部分,其中網路位址可以使用以下形式描述:192.168.0.0/16,其中斜線後的數字表示網路位址部分的長度是16位,這對應2個位元組,即網路位址部分是192.168.0.0。

ipv6位址

IPv6是英文「Internet Protocol Version 6」(網際網路協定第6版)的縮寫,是網路工程任務組(IETF)設計的用於替代IPv4的下一代IP協議,其地址數量號稱可以為全世界的每一粒沙子編上一個地址。

由於IPv4最大的問題在於網路位址資源不足,嚴重限制了網路的應用和發展。 IPv6的使用,不僅能解決網路位址資源數量的問題,也解決了多種接取設備連入網際網路的障礙。

IPv6的設計目的是取代IPv4,然而長期以來IPv4在網路流量中仍佔據主要地位,IPv6的使用成長緩慢。在2022年4月,透過IPv6使用Google服務的用戶百分率首次超過40%。

IPv6的位址長度為128位,是IPv4位址長度的4倍。一個IPv6的IP位址由8個位址節組成,每節包含16個位址位,總長度是16x8=128位。

ipv4位址是ip位址嗎

於是IPv4點分十進位格式不再適用,採用十六進位表示法。

IPv6有3種表示方法:

1、冒分十六進位表示法

#格式為X:X:X:X:X:X:X:X,其中每個X表示位址中的16b,以十六進位表示,例如:

ABCD:EF01: 2345:6789:ABCD:EF01:2345:6789

這種表示法中,每個X的前導0​​是可以省略的,例如:

#2001:0DB8:0000:0023: 0008:0800:200C:417A→ 2001:DB8:0:23:8:800:200C:417A

#2、0位元壓縮表示法

在某某

2、0位元壓縮表示法

在某某某

2、0位元壓縮表示法

在某一有些情況下,一個IPv6位址中間可能包含很長的一段0,可以把連續的一段0壓縮為「::」。但為保證位址解析的唯一性,位址中」::」只能出現一次,例如:

FF01:0:0:0:0:0:0:1101 → FF01::11010:0:0:0:0:0:0:1 → ::10:0:0:0:0:0:0:0 → ::

3、內嵌IPv4位址表示法

為了實現IPv4-IPv6互通,IPv4位址會嵌入IPv6位址中,此時位址常表示為:X:X:X :X:X:X:d.d.d.d,前96b採用冒分十六進位表示,而最後32b位址則使用IPv4的點分十進位表示,例如::192.168.0.1與::FFFF:192.168.0.1就是兩個典型的例子,注意在前96b中,壓縮0位元的方法依舊適用

#ipv6位址類型

IPv6協定主要定義了三種位址類型:單播位址(Unicast Address)、群播位址(Multicast Address)和任播位址(Anycast Address)。與原來在IPv4位址相比,新增了「任播位址」類型,取消了原來IPv4位址中的廣播位址,因為在IPv6中的廣播功能是透過組播來完成的。 任播位址:用來識別一組介面(通常這組介面屬於不同的節點)。傳送到任播位址的資料封包傳送給此位址所識別的一組介面中距離來源節點最近(根據使用的路由協定進行度量)的一個介面。 #未指定位址00…0(128 bits)::/128## 環回位址##連結本地位址#從單播位址空間中分配,使用單播位址的格式
單播位址:用來唯一標識一個接口,類似IPv4中的單播位址。傳送到單播位址的資料封包將會傳送給此位址所標識的一個介面。 組播位址:用來識別一組介面(通常這組介面屬於不同的節點),類似IPv4中的組播位址。傳送到組播位址的資料封包傳送給此位址所標識的所有介面。
IPv6位址類型是由位址前綴部分來決定,主要位址類型與位址前綴的對應關係如下:
位址類型
位址前綴(二進位)
IPv6前綴標識
#單播位址
00…1(128 bits)
#::1/128
1111111010
FE80::/10
##### ##唯一本機位址############1111 110############FC00::/7######(包括FD00::/8和###
不常用的FC00::/8)
網站本地位址(已棄用,被唯一本地位址取代)
#1111111011
FEC0::/10
全域單播位址
其他形式
-
組播位址

11111111
#FF00::/8
##任播位址

IPv4和IPv6協定的區別

##1、協議位址的區別

1)、位址長度

IPv4協定具有32位元(4位元組)位址長度;IPv6協定具有128位元(16位元組)位址長度

ipv4位址是ip位址嗎

2)、位址的表示方法

IPv4位址是以小數表示的二進位數。 IPv6位址是以十六進位表示的二進制數。

3)位址設定

IPv4協定的位址可以透過手動或DHCP配置的。 【相關影片教學建議:HTTP影片教學

IPv4協定需要使用Internet控制訊息協定版本6(ICMPv6)或DHCPv6的無狀態位址自動設定(SLAAC)。

2、封包的區別

1)、套件的大小

IPv4協定的封包需要576個位元組,碎片可選。 IPv6協定的資料包需要1280個字節,不會碎片

2)、包頭

IPv4協定的包頭的長度為20個字節,不識別用於QoS處理的數據包流,包含checksum,包含最多40個位元組的選項欄位。

IPv6協定的包頭的長度為40個字節,包含指定QoS處理的資料包流的Flow Label字段,不包含checksum;IPv6協定沒有字段,但IPv6擴充標頭可用。

3)封包碎片

IPv4協定的封包碎片會由轉送路由器和傳送主機完成。 IPv6協定的封包碎片僅由傳送主機完成。

ipv4位址是ip位址嗎

3、DNS記錄

#IPv4協定的位址(A)記錄,對應主機名稱;指標(PTR)記錄, IN-ADDR.ARPA DNS域。

IPv6協定的位址(AAAA)記錄,對應主機名稱;指標(PTR)記錄,IP6.ARPA DNS域

4、IPSec支援

#IPv4協定的IPSec支援只是可選的。 IPv4協定有內建的IPSec支援。

5、位址解析協定

IPv4協定:位址解析協定(ARP)可用來將IPv4位址對應到MAC位址。

IPv6協定:位址解析協定(ARP)被鄰居發現協定(NDP)的功能所取代。

6、驗證和加密

Pv6提供身份驗證和加密,但IPv4不提供。

更多相關知識,請造訪常見問題

欄位! ###

以上是ipv4位址是ip位址嗎的詳細內容。更多資訊請關注PHP中文網其他相關文章!

相關標籤:
來源:php.cn
本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n
熱門教學
更多>
最新下載
更多>
網站特效
網站源碼
網站素材
前端模板